National Fudge Day 2023 – Friday, June 16! Have you ever heard someone say, “Oh, fudge!” once they’ve messed up something they weren’t supposed to do? The rich candy-like confection recognized as fudge is thought to have been created by accident. As per mythology, a confectioner messed up while making caramel and eventually became the accidental food that we know of as fudge these days.  On June 16, National Fudge Day, we commemorate this pleasant occurrence. Fudge Day is an amazing holiday for foodies since it allows one to indulge in his or her favorite treat. Several popular fudge varieties are chocolate, peanut butter, chocolate nut, maple, and maple nut.

How To Celebrate National Fudge Day 2023?

Make plans to attend the Mackinac Island Fudge Festival.

Mackinac Island, Michigan, is a 4.35-square-mile island with over a dozen fudge businesses despite having a permanent population of barely 500 people. The famed fudge destination’s commemoration does not have to overlap with National Fudge Day. Each year, a large number of people travel to observe the fudge-making method, sample fudge-infused cocktails produced by local mixologists, or seek for one of many “golden tickets” concealed within fudge boxes, that entitle victors to a free vacation package. The event takes place in April, so there’s plenty of chance to acquire your reservations.

What is the origin of Fudge?

The first reference to fudge, as per historical archives, may be discovered in Emelyn Hartridge’s letters whilst she was still a student at Vassar College in Poughkeepsie, New York. This letter described the creation of fudge and marketed in Baltimore, Maryland around 1886. Aside from this letter, another reference to making fudge can be found in the United States around the late nineteenth and early twentieth centuries.
